本文目录导读:
关系型数据库管理系统(RDBMS)作为数据库技术的重要组成部分,已经成为当今企业级应用的核心技术之一,RDBMS凭借其稳定、高效、易用等特点,广泛应用于金融、电信、教育、医疗等多个领域,本文将从RDBMS的定义、原理、应用等方面进行详细介绍,以帮助读者全面了解这一技术。
RDBMS的定义
关系型数据库管理系统(RDBMS)是一种基于关系模型的数据库管理系统,它将数据以表格形式存储,每个表格由行和列组成,行代表记录,列代表字段,RDBMS通过SQL(结构化查询语言)实现对数据的增、删、改、查等操作。
RDBMS的核心原理
1、关系模型
图片来源于网络,如有侵权联系删除
关系模型是RDBMS的核心,它将数据以表格形式组织,关系模型包括以下几个要素:
(1)实体:实体是现实世界中具有独立存在意义的对象,如人、物、事件等。
(2)属性:属性是实体的特征,如人的姓名、年龄、性别等。
(3)关系:关系是实体之间的联系,如朋友关系、师生关系等。
2、关系代数
关系代数是RDBMS的理论基础,它通过一系列的运算操作对关系进行查询、更新等操作,关系代数包括以下运算:
(1)选择:从关系中选取满足条件的记录。
(2)投影:从关系中选取指定的属性。
(3)连接:将两个关系按照指定的条件进行合并。
图片来源于网络,如有侵权联系删除
(4)并、交、差:对关系进行合并、相交、差集等操作。
3、SQL语言
SQL语言是RDBMS的标准查询语言,它具有丰富的功能,包括数据定义、数据查询、数据更新、数据控制等,SQL语言主要包含以下几个部分:
(1)数据定义语言(DDL):用于定义数据库结构,如创建表、修改表等。
(2)数据操纵语言(DML):用于对数据进行增、删、改、查等操作。
(3)数据控制语言(DCL):用于对数据库的访问权限进行控制。
RDBMS的应用
1、企业级应用
RDBMS在企业级应用中具有广泛的应用,如ERP(企业资源计划)、CRM(客户关系管理)、HR(人力资源管理)等,这些应用通过RDBMS对企业的各类数据进行统一管理和分析,提高企业运营效率。
2、数据库存储
图片来源于网络,如有侵权联系删除
RDBMS是数据库存储的主流技术,它具有以下优势:
(1)数据结构清晰:关系模型使数据结构清晰易懂,便于维护。
(2)数据安全性高:RDBMS提供多种安全机制,如用户权限、数据加密等。
(3)事务处理能力强:RDBMS支持事务处理,确保数据的一致性和完整性。
3、数据分析
RDBMS在数据分析领域具有重要作用,如数据挖掘、统计分析等,通过RDBMS,可以对海量数据进行高效处理和分析,为企业决策提供有力支持。
关系型数据库管理系统(RDBMS)作为数据库技术的重要组成部分,具有广泛的应用前景,本文从RDBMS的定义、原理、应用等方面进行了详细介绍,旨在帮助读者全面了解这一技术,随着数据库技术的不断发展,RDBMS将在未来发挥更加重要的作用。
标签: #关系型数据库管理系统简称为rdbms
评论列表